Allerton Manor Golf Club is the Perfect Liverpool Wedding Venue

Allerton Manor Golf Club is a wonderful setting to be a wedding photographer. It is a very new and exciting wedding venue, which really ticks all the boxes. The Hay loft and adjoining bar and terrace are perfect for up to 80 day guests and a further 40 guests (totalling 120) in the evening. It is hard to take bad images at this amazing wedding venue. The light in the hayloft is perfect for great photographs during the wedding ceremony.

Set in the leafy South Liverpool, Allerton Manor Golf Club is the venue to have the perfect wedding. With superb grounds to capture some very special couple portraits. This wedding venue is now in my top ten Liverpool venues and I can’t wait to be asked back to photograph another wedding here.
